Jayson Tatum is likely to miss most or all of the Boston Celtics season due to a torn Achilles, but there is some hope that he could return before the playoffs begin next April.
If Tautm is going to return to action within the year, he’ll need to ensure he doesn’t have any setbacks while rehabbing, and so far, he is off to a good start.
During 98.5 The Sports Hub’s “Zolak & Bertrand,” Marc Bertrand shared exciting news on Tatum’s rehab.
“The Celtics are very happy with how hard Jayson Tatum has been working at his rehab and his level of focus and intensity in the rehab process,” Bertrand said Thursday.
Tatum has been rehabbing in Boston, which is significant because many players with major injuries often leave their team and recover in another state.
